欢迎来到天天文库
浏览记录
ID:17877328
大小:55.00 KB
页数:9页
时间:2018-09-07
《光隔开关量输出板》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、PC-6411光隔开关量输出板用户手册PC-6411光隔开关量输出板技术说明书1.概述PC-6411光隔开关量输出板是为PC-BUSISA总线的486/586系列的原装机、兼容机及工控机而设计的接口板,它适用于工业现场开关状态变化的输出。考虑到在开关量的输入输出中“开”和“关”的暂态对计算机干扰十分强烈及现场办公强电的干扰,本板采用了光电隔离技术,使计算机与现场信号之间全部隔离,提高了抗干扰能力。本板有32路开关量输出,具有P-N-P晶体管扩流电路,非常适用于电流下拉型电路现场。2.主要技术指标2.132路开
2、关量输出。2.2最大输出电流:200mA,可直接驱动继电器。2.3各路信号与接口板之间隔离电平:500V。2.4本板共占用主机连续4个I/O地址口。3.工作原理PC-6411板由32路输出寄存器、光电隔离电路、晶体管扩流电路和外部电源变换电路等几部分组成。3.1布局图如下:光电藕合器和晶体管扩流电路寄存器DIP3.2外部电源:本板的外部电源可以是12V或24V.4.操作说明本板的开出信号分为4组,每组8路,通过锁存器输出。4.1I/O地址分配:地址开关的设置:本板共占用主机连续4个I/O端口,通过拨动板上的地
3、址开关DIP而设定,各位代表的意义如下:A2~A9A2~A9(a)300H(b)184H图1I/0基地址选择举例4.2I/O地址表示功能:表1端口地址与功能表端口操作地址操作命令功能BASE+OIOW写输出1~8通道数据BASE+1IOW写输出9~16通道数据BASE+2IOW写输出17~24通道数据BASE+3IOW写输出25~32通道数据4.3输出插座接口定义:表2输出插座接口定义表插座引脚号信号定义插座引脚号信号定义1DOUT120DOUT22DOUT321DOUT43DOUT522DOUT64DOUT
4、723DOUT85DOUT924DOUT106DOUT1125DOUT127DOUT1326DOUT148DOUT1527DOUT169+12V28数字地10数字地29DOUT1811DOUT1730DOUT2012DOUT1931DOUT2213DOUT2132DOUT2414DOUT2333DOUT2615DOUT2534DOUT2816DOUT2735DOUT3017DOUT2936DOUT3218DOUT3137+12V19数字地4.4开出信号的操作:写32路开出信号的端口与数据对应关系如下:端口地址
5、操作命令D7D6D5D4D3D2D1D0基地址+0IOWDOUT8DOUT7DOUT6DOUT5DOUT4DOUT3DOUT2DOUT1基地址+1IOWDOUT16DOUT15DOUT14DOUT13DOUT12DOUT11DOUT10DOUT9基地址+2IOWDOUT24DOUT23DOUT22DOUT21DOUT20DOUT19DOUT18DOUT17基地址+3IOWDOUT32DOUT31DOUT30DOUT29DOUT28DOUT27DOUT26DOUT25注意:当PC-6411外接K-805继电器板
6、、K-806固态继电器板时,当37芯D型插头为高电平输出时,继电器释放,继电器灯熄灭;当37芯D型插头为低电平输出时,继电器吸合,继电器灯点亮。5.驱动程序简介∶PC-6000系列演示程序及驱动程序是为PC-6000系列多功能工控采集板配制的工作在中西文Windows95/98/NT环境下的一组驱动程序以及使用该驱动程序组建的一个演示程序,可以方便地使用户在中西文Windows环境下检测硬件的工作状态以及帮助软件开发人员在常用的CC++,VisualBasic,Delphi,BorlandC++Builde
7、r,BorlandPascalforwindows等开发环境中使用PC-6000系列工控采集板进行数据采集和过程控制等工作.驱动程序是一个标准动态链接库(DLL文件)。它的输出函数可以被其它应用程序在运行时直接调用。用户的应用程序可以用任何一种可以使用DLL链接库的编程工具来编写。每种板卡依据其自身功能的不同具有不同的输出函数和参数定义。驱动程序输出函数定义∶所列函数的说明格式为VC++6.0环境下PC6000.Dll库函数的原函数格式,无论使用哪一种开发工具,务必请注意数据格式的匹配及函数的返回类型,本说明
8、中所使用的数据类型定义如下:short~16位带符号数unsignedchar-8位无符号数*函数:voidAPIENTRYDO6411Bit(shortnAdd,shortnBit,unsignedcharnState)功能:进行某一个通道的数字量数据输出操作。参数:nAdd基地址nBit通道号:0-31nState1表示将输出高电平,0表示将输出低电平。返回:无返回值*函数:voidAPIENT
此文档下载收益归作者所有